摘要
利用大鼠肝再生增强因子(augmenterofliverregeneration,ALR)核苷酸序列,从人胎肝cDNA文库中筛选到人肝再生增强因子cDNA克隆,该克隆含有1.5kb的外源插入片段,核苷酸序列测定表明含375bp的读码框架,能编码125个氨基酸的蛋白质;与大鼠肝再生增强因子相比,核苷酸序列同源性达87%,氨基酸序列同源性达84.8%。
In order to isolate cDNA encoding complete human augmenter of liver regeneration (ALR), the strategy of screening an arrayed human fetal cDNA library by PCR was adopted. Three positive clones obtained after 10 6 recombinants from the human fetal liver cDNA library were screened. The sequence analysis showed that these clones covered the coding region of human ALR, with 87% homology to rat ALR.
